Output 2091483c188d838386df8a73fdc8290020a048e985165bfccc7ad1db6bd01ffa:0

value
42116754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b045764a5742e3104ceb0aee333b99d6387950 OP_EQUAL
address
MFXfUu7PUqE7ytp3UbJcQnxihmc87MYDMA
transaction
2091483c188d838386df8a73fdc8290020a048e985165bfccc7ad1db6bd01ffa
spent
true